Perfect World Announces Recent Business Developments

2013-05-28 17:16 1185

BEIJING, May 28, 2013 /PRNewswire/ -- Perfect World Co., Ltd. (NASDAQ: PWRD) ("Perfect World" or the "Company"), a leading online game developer and operator based in China, today announced its recent business developments as of May 28, 2013.

WEB GAME

Launch of "Gourmet Adventurer"

On May 13, 2013, Perfect World launched its 2D turn-based cartoon-style web game "Gourmet Adventurer" in China. "Gourmet Adventurer" is a cuisine-themed role-playing web game that features an elimination-based combat style, fresh and cute graphics, and straightforward and enjoyable player controls, offering players enriched gameplay and an interactive entertainment experience.

MOBILE GAMES

In May 2013, Perfect World launched three mobile games in China, including the card game "Legend of Chu and Han," the SLG game "Rise of The King," and the 2D turn-based RPG game "Return of the Condor Heroes."

EXPANSION PACKS

Recently, Perfect World released expansion packs for a couple of its games. On May 23, 2013, Perfect World released the expansion pack "Mounted Might" for its 2D turn-based MMORPG "Return of the Condor Heroes." On May 28, 2013, Perfect World released the expansion pack "World Conquest" for its 3D MMORPG "Zhu Xian."

OVERSEAS OPERATIONS

Launch of English, French, and German Versions of "Neverwinter" in the U.S. and Europe

On April 30, 2013, Perfect World launched open beta testing for the English, French, and German versions of "Neverwinter" in the U.S. and Europe through its subsidiaries. "Neverwinter" is a widely-acclaimed MMORPG developed by Cryptic Studios, Perfect World's subsidiary based in the U.S. Set in the background of epic stories, the beautiful artwork and fast-paced action combat in the game deliver an intense and exciting gaming experience to players.

Launch of "Forsaken World" in Turkey

In May 2013, Perfect World launched "Forsaken World" in Turkey through its European subsidiary. "Forsaken World" is Perfect World's 3D MMORPG set against the backdrop of a fantasy world. The game was first launched in Mainland China in October 2010 and has been licensed to dozens of countries and regions.

OVERSEAS LAUNCH THROUGH LICENSEE

Launch of "Forsaken World" in Vietnam

In May 2013, Perfect World launched "Forsaken World" in Vietnam through CMN Viet Nam Online Joint Stock Company, an online game operator in Vietnam.

About Perfect World Co., Ltd. (http://www.pwrd.com)

Perfect World Co., Ltd. (NASDAQ: PWRD) is a leading online game developer and operator based in China. Perfect World primarily develops online games based on proprietary game engines and game development platforms. Perfect World's strong technology and creative game design capabilities, combined with extensive knowledge and experiences in the online game market, enable it to frequently and promptly introduce popular games designed to cater changing customer preferences and market trends. Perfect World's current portfolio of self-developed online games includes massively multiplayer online role playing games ("MMORPGs"): "Perfect World," "Legend of Martial Arts," "Perfect World II," "Zhu Xian," "Chi Bi," "Pocketpet Journey West," "Battle of the Immortals," "Fantasy Zhu Xian," "Forsaken World," "Dragon Excalibur," "Empire of the Immortals," "Return of the Condor Heroes" and "Saint Seiya Online;" an online casual game: "Hot Dance Party;" and a number of web games and mobile games. While a majority of the revenues are generated in China, Perfect World operates its games in North America, Europe, Japan, Korea, and Southeast Asia through its own subsidiaries. Perfect World's games have also been licensed to leading game operators in a number of countries and regions in Asia, Latin America, Australia, New Zealand, and the Russian Federation and other Russian speaking territories. Perfect World intends to continue to explore new and innovative business models and is committed to maximizing shareholder value over time.
